Description

This agreement appoints a person as a sales representative for a company, and emphasizes that this is an “exclusive” appointment. The agreement limits the Representative’s duties to certain territories and products, and attaches a list of the particular products to be sold by the representative. The agreement provides both a definition of confidential information and a reminder of the representative’s duty not to disclose that information. The sole compensation to be paid by the company to the representative consists of a commission on sales of the products within the territory of the representative.

The Indiana Agreement with Sales Representative is a legal document that establishes a mutually beneficial relationship between a company and an individual acting as a sales representative. This agreement outlines the terms and conditions under which the sales representative will promote and sell the company's products or services within the state of Indiana. It provides a framework for both parties to understand their rights, obligations, and expectations. The Indiana Agreement with Sales Representative typically includes key elements such as: 1. Parties involved: The agreement identifies the company as the principal and the sales representative as the agent. It states their names, addresses, and contact information. 2. Scope of representation: The agreement defines the territory or region within Indiana where the sales representative can operate. It outlines whether the representative has exclusive rights to sell the company's products/services, or if other representatives may be appointed within the same territory. 3. Product or service description: The agreement contains a detailed description of the products or services that the sales representative will be responsible for selling. This section may include specifications, pricing, delivery terms, and any limitations. 4. Responsibilities: The agreement outlines the responsibilities of both parties. It mentions the sales representative's duty to promote and market the company's products/services diligently and ethically. The company is expected to provide the necessary resources, training, and support to enable the sales representative to perform their role effectively. 5. Commission and compensation: The agreement specifies the commission structure or compensation plan for the sales representative. It may include details on specific commission rates, bonuses, sales targets, and payment terms. 6. Term and termination: The agreement states the initial term of the agreement and whether it will automatically renew or require mutual agreement for extension. It also outlines the conditions under which either party can terminate the agreement, such as breach of contract, non-performance, or violation of any terms. 7. Confidentiality and non-compete: The agreement may include clauses that protect the company's confidential information, trade secrets, and client data. It may also define non-compete terms, preventing the sales representative from engaging in similar sales activities within a specified period and geographic area after the agreement ends. Different types of Indiana Agreements with Sales Representative may exist based on various factors, including the nature of the products or services being sold, the industry involved, and the specific needs of the parties involved. Some examples include: 1. Exclusive Sales Representative Agreement: This type of agreement grants the sales representative exclusive rights to sell the company's products or services within a specific territory of Indiana. It ensures that no other representatives, either hired by the company or third-party agents, can sell within that territory. 2. Non-Exclusive Sales Representative Agreement: Unlike the exclusive agreement, this type allows the company to appoint multiple sales representatives within the same territory. Each representative operates independently and shares sales opportunities without exclusivity. 3. Commission-Only Sales Representative Agreement: This agreement compensates the sales representative solely through commissions based on the sales they generate. It does not provide a fixed salary or base income. 4. Sales Agency Agreement: This type of agreement appoints the sales representative as an agent of the company to act on their behalf in negotiating and closing sales contracts. It may grant the representative signing authority and further define their legal relationship.
